Mechanicsville Swamp
Mechanicsville Swamp is in Lee, South Carolina. Mechanicsville Swamp is situated nearby to the hamlet DuBose Crossroads, as well as near Ashwood.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Oswego
Hamlet
Oswego is a census-designated place in Sumter County, South Carolina, United States. The population was 95 at the 2000 census. It is included in the Sumter, South Carolina Metropolitan Statistical Area. Oswego is situated 5 miles south of Mechanicsville Swamp.
